The rains bring relief from the scorching summer, but for our pets, the monsoon season can also mean health risks, discomfort, and infections. As a responsible pet parent, you must take extra precautions to ensure your furry companion stays happy and healthy during this time. Here are some essential monsoon pet care tips recommended by experts at Pet-First Pet Hospital. 1. Keep Your Pet Dry and Comfortable Moisture is the biggest enemy during monsoon. Wet fur creates a breeding ground for bacteria, fungi, and parasites. Always wipe your pet with a clean, dry towel after walks in the rain. Use a blow dryer on low heat for dogs with thick coats. Keep paws dry – damp paws often lead to infections and itching. Consider raincoats or waterproof jackets for dogs during walks. 2. Maintain Paw Hygiene Paws are the first to come in contact with mud, puddles, and dirty water. This makes them vulnerable to fungal infections. Wash paws with lukewarm water after every walk. Check the spaces between paw pads for cuts or ticks. Apply vet-recommended antiseptic sprays or paw balms to prevent cracks and irritation. 3. Watch Out for Skin Infections Fungal and bacterial infections are common in the rainy season. Pets may show symptoms like itching, redness, hair loss, or foul odor. Brush your pet’s coat daily to prevent matting and allow air circulation. Use antifungal or medicated shampoos prescribed by a vet. Keep bedding dry and wash it frequently. At Pet-First, our dermatology experts provide customized treatments for skin issues that commonly flare up during monsoon. 4. Prevent Tick and Flea Infestation Humidity attracts ticks and fleas, which can transmit diseases like tick fever. Use vet-approved anti-tick collars, sprays, or spot-on treatments. Regularly check ears, underarms, and tail area for ticks. Keep your home surroundings clean and free from stagnant water. 5. Boost Immunity with a Healthy Diet A strong immune system helps pets fight infections. Feed a balanced diet with high-quality protein. Add immunity-boosting foods recommended by your vet (e.g., omega-3 fatty acids, vitamins). Avoid raw food during monsoon, as it spoils faster and can upset the stomach. Keep fresh drinking water available – change it often to prevent contamination. 6. Exercise Indoors When Needed Continuous rains can limit outdoor activities, leading to restlessness and obesity. Play fetch or tug-of-war indoors. Hide treats in toys for mental stimulation. Short indoor agility activities (like small jumps) keep them active and entertained. 7. Be Cautious with Walks Avoid letting your pet step into stagnant water or muddy puddles – they may contain harmful bacteria or sharp objects. Choose cleaner, higher ground paths. Stick to shorter, more frequent walks instead of long ones. Wipe their underside and legs thoroughly once you return. 8. Keep Ears and Eyes Clean Moisture can cause ear infections, especially in dogs with floppy ears. Clean ears gently with a vet-recommended solution. Watch out for signs of infection: shaking head, scratching ears, foul smell. Keep hair around the eyes trimmed to prevent irritation from rainwater. 9. Regular Vet Checkups are Essential During monsoon, pets are more prone to: Gastrointestinal infections Respiratory issues Skin allergies Tick-borne fevers Routine checkups at a trusted pet hospital in Jubilee Hills like Pet-First help in early detection and treatment. 10. Keep Anxiety in Check Thunderstorms, heavy rains, and loud noises can make pets anxious. Create a safe, quiet corner for them at home. Keep curtains drawn to block lightning flashes. Use calming toys, pheromone diffusers, or simply stay close to reassure them. Monsoon can be a fun season for pets if handled with care. By keeping them dry, hygienic, tick-free, well-fed, and emotionally secure, you can ensure your furry companions enjoy the rains safely. Everything You Need for Pet Boarding in Hyderabad

Pet Boarding in Hyderabad

Everything You Need for Pet Boarding in Hyderabad – A Handy Parent Checklist Planning a trip and worrying about taking off without your furry baby? That combination of excitement for your vacation and guilt for leaving your pet behind can be overwhelming. But with the right preparation, pet boarding doesn’t have to be a heartbreak. It can be a mini-vacation for them as well. Pet boarding ensures that your pet is safe, cozy, and loved when you’re away. Here is everything you need for pet boarding services in Hyderabad. Home Away from Other Home: Bring the Comforts They Know  Entering a new place can be perplexing for your pets. The secret to calming them down? Create a comforting, immersive environment that reminds them of home, especially using familiar smells that evoke memories, warmth, and safety. Fill their favorite bed or blanket, the one they sleep on every time. Add in a squeaky toy they simply can’t do without or even one of your old shirts. Your scent, surprisingly enough, is very soothing to them. A little bit of home makes their temporary residence a lot less foreign. No Hungry Bellies: Observe Their Regular Feeding Schedule Pet boarding centers ensure your pet’s belly is filled with the food they love, providing excellent temporary care for pets. Travel can throw your routine into chaos, but your pet’s diet should not be sacrificed. Premium Pet Boarding in Hyderabad offers nutritious food & treats and provides your pet with enough normal food based on dietary requirements. Trained professionals who understand your pet’s unique needs and give the appropriate quantity and frequency. If your pet has allergies or restrictions, notify the crew far in advance. You don’t want some unexpected tummy ailments while traveling. Health Comes First: Meds, Vets & Must-Knows If your pet is on medication or supplements, send them to premium pet boarding facilities in Hyderabad with obviously marked dosage instructions. Write down any applicable health issues, from arthritis to sensitive skin. Leave your vet’s phone number handy, just in case. And don’t miss allergies to food, dust, or even fear-based ones like loud noises. The more caretakers know, the better they can care. Papers, please: Get Vaccines in Line  This is non-negotiable. The best pet boarding homes in Hyderabad need all pets to be current on their shots. Ensure that your pet has had their rabies vaccine, parvo and distemper shot (for dogs), and feline combo shots (for cats). Most will also inquire about recent flea and tick treatment. Bring printed or electronic documentation. Your vet can readily generate this if you don’t have it on hand. Personality Counts: Tell Your Pet’s Style Is your dog the social butterfly or lone wolf? Does your cat sleep under the bed on stormy nights or meow through the night when alone? Small facts like these can assist caretakers in treating your pet just like you do, with understanding and patience. Provide them with what soothes them, what they like to play, which commands to obey, and what could bring on stress. Allowing them to be catered to individually really does make a difference. Stay Connected: Leave Your Contact Trail  Emergencies do not happen often, but being prepared helps. Leave contact information, and if you are going out of the country or will be out of touch, provide pet boarding service providers in Hyderabad with an alternative number, such as a friend or relative. Include your vet’s contact, and if your pet is microchipped, provide pet care companies with that information as well. See Their Tail Wag: Request Daily Updates You’re not overprotecting; you simply adore your furball. Most pet boarding facilities in Hyderabad these days send daily photos or videos via WhatsApp or even mention you on Instagram. Request it. Seeing your precious pet play, sleep, or just be cute can make you forget about your guilt and allow you to enjoy your vacation without remorse. Choose the Best Fit: Not All Pet Boarding is Created Equal Hyderabad has lots of wonderful pet boarding centers, but they are different. Go to a premium pet boarding facility in Hyderabad beforehand, inspect for cleanliness, observe how employees work with animals, and inquire about their emergency protocol. Read testimonials, request trial days, and speak with other pet parents for honest opinions. A good facility won’t just keep your pet with them, they’ll care for them like family.
